acanthus - acan·thus
The thorny leaf of an herb native to the Mediterranean region,
the design of which has been used as a stylized motif throughout history.
Of special note is its use in capitals of the Corinthian and composite order.
It sometimes resembles the leaves of dandelion, thistle or artichoke plants,
pinnately lobed with spiny margins.
Gouache
Pronounced gwahsh, as in squash.
A painting medium in which watercolor
is mixed with opaque white pigment.
Applied in the same way as watercolor,
gouache gives a chalky finish similar
to that of tempera painting.
Poster paints are usually a form of gouache.
Any painting
produced with
this medium is called a gouache.
